The Role
- Understanding the clients project requirements
- Understand the NEC contract requirements
- Understand the Framework agreement requirements
- Produce and maintain project programme
- Coordinate monthly updates from the project teams including subcontractors
- Produce monthly reports for the team & client including narratives.
- Cost load and resource load the programme
- Work with estimating and commercial teams on tender projects
- Produce monthly progress reports
- Monitor and Track change control
Main Duties and Responsibilities
- The main duties and responsibilities of the Planner are outlined as follows:
- Liaise with the project teams to baseline programme
- Liaise with the client planning manager
- Monitor and track with the project team progress of the project through all phases
- Compilation of Weekly / monthly reports as dictated by the project
- Issue monthly programme updates in line with the contract requirements.
- Monitoring performance of the subcontractors against programme
- Attend collaborative meetings with the client
- Attend collaborative meetings with the subcontractors and project teams
- Break out package of specific works as required by the project team.
- Report Change to the project manager for acceptance
Knowledge, Skills and Experience
Experience/Qualifications Needed
- 5 years demonstrated Planning experience
- Competent in the use of Primavera P6
- Primavera P6 certified or demonstratable experience
- Experience of working within a multidiscipline team
- Working knowledge of the NEC suite of contracts
- Demonstratable knowledge of construction methods

- About Glanua
Glanua are industry leaders in providing project solutions for the water and wastewater industry including design, construction, commissioning, operation and maintenance.
At Glanua, we believe that innovation is key when it comes to creating value for our clients and so we continue to lead the way when it comes to providing innovative designs and integrating global technologies.
Glanua UK, as part of the Glanua Group, offers turnkey solutions through its process, MEICA, civil and structural design/build capabilities.
This allows us to take our clients problems, find a solution and deliver to completion as a single entity.
Glanua operate and maintain a wide range of water and wastewater treatment facilities nationwide.
We guarantee the provision of safe drinking water to thousands of always people & ensure environmental compliance from our wastewater treatment plants.
We have a talented team in the Glanua Group of 450+ people across Ireland and the UK and are rapidly expanding our workforce across several disciplines to meet our ambitious growth plans.
